A non-profit health system north of Detroit is growing its Gastroenterology team. This health system covers a 26-county region with medical centers that span across Northeast and Central Michigan. In addition to its medical centers, they also offer both home health care and physician services and has a strong commitment to medical education.
Position Highlights:
· Opportunities exist for General Outpatient Only GI and GI Hospitalist
· Join a collaborative team of experienced physicians and dedicated GI APPs in a supportive and collegial environment.
· Outpatient | Weekly schedule consists of one clinic day and three procedure days
· Inpatient | Options for 7-on 7-off or 14-on 14-off Block Schedule
· Comprehensive mentorship and ramp-up support ensure a seamless transition, with immediate patient volume available—they are the sole GI provider in Northern and parts of Central Michigan.
· Engage in academic opportunities by teaching residents and medical students.
· Competitive compensation package, including a generous $200K sign-on bonus and comprehensive benefits.
· J-1 and H-1B visa sponsorship available.
This northern city in Michigan offers a charming blend of small-town warmth and modern amenities, making it an attractive place to live. Known for its strong economy, thanks to the presence of Dow Chemical, the city boasts excellent schools, beautiful parks, and a vibrant arts scene. Outdoor enthusiasts can enjoy the scenic Chippewa Nature Center, Dow Gardens, and the Pere Marquette Rail Trail. With a friendly community, low crime rates, and a cost of living lower than the national average, this city provides a high quality of life for families and professionals alike.
